Energy production is indeed proportional to the cube of wind speed due to the reliance of power generation on the kinetic energy formula, which includes the wind velocity raised to the third power.
Step-by-step explanation:
The statement that energy production is proportional to the cube of the wind speed is true, as indicated by the formula for kinetic energy. This relationship means that a small increase in wind speed results in a large increase in the power available from a wind turbine. To exemplify, if wind speed doubles, the energy production increases by a factor of eight because the power of wind is related to the density of the air, the area swept by the wind turbine blades, and the cube of the wind velocity.
